Understanding the Bitaxe Ultra: A Foundation for Upgrades
Before diving into modifications, it’s essential to understand the core components of the Bitaxe Ultra and how they contribute to its performance:
- BM1366 ASIC Chip: The heart of the Bitaxe Ultra, delivering a hashrate of 500 GH/s with just 15 watts of power consumption. This chip is renowned for its energy efficiency, achieving approximately 33.3 GH/s per watt.
- ESP32-S3-WROOM-1 Development Board: Provides robust control and flexibility, enabling direct interaction with the Bitcoin network. With 16MB of flash storage, it ensures reliable operation and firmware adaptability.
- Compact Design: Measuring just 10 x 6 cm and weighing 73 grams, the Bitaxe Ultra is designed for versatility in deployment scenarios.
- Cooling System: Offers flexibility with both standard and premium Noctua fan options, ensuring optimal thermal management.
These components form the foundation for any upgrades or modifications. By understanding their roles, you can make informed decisions about which areas to enhance.

Practical Upgrades and Modifications for the Bitaxe Ultra
1. Optimizing the Cooling System
Thermal management is critical for maintaining stable performance and prolonging the lifespan of your ASIC miner. Here’s how you can enhance cooling:
- Upgrade to a Premium Fan: While the Bitaxe Ultra comes with a standard fan, upgrading to a premium Noctua fan can significantly improve airflow and reduce noise levels.
- Install Additional Heat Sinks: Adding heat sinks to the BM1366 ASIC chip and other critical components can enhance heat dissipation.
- Improve Ventilation: Ensure your mining setup has adequate ventilation. Consider placing the Bitaxe Ultra in a well-ventilated enclosure or using external fans to improve airflow.
Real-World Impact: Better cooling not only prevents overheating but also allows the ASIC chip to operate at peak efficiency, potentially increasing the hashrate over time.
2. Overclocking for Higher Hashrate
Overclocking involves increasing the clock speed of the BM1366 ASIC chip to achieve a higher hashrate. Here’s how to approach it:
- Use Custom Firmware: The open-source nature of the Bitaxe Ultra allows for custom firmware that supports overclocking. Look for community-developed firmware with overclocking capabilities.
- Monitor Temperature and Power Consumption: Overclocking generates more heat and consumes more power. Use monitoring tools to ensure the device remains within safe operating limits.
- Gradual Adjustments: Start with small increments in clock speed and test stability before making further adjustments.
Real-World Impact: Overclocking can increase the hashrate by 10-20%, improving your chances of solving a block. However, it’s essential to balance performance with thermal management.

4. Power Supply Optimization
The Bitaxe Ultra’s low power consumption makes it ideal for energy-conscious miners. Here’s how to optimize the power supply:
- Use a High-Efficiency PSU: Choose a power supply unit (PSU) with high efficiency (80+ Gold or Platinum) to minimize energy losses.
- Voltage Tuning: Some custom firmware allows for voltage adjustments, which can reduce power consumption without sacrificing performance.
- Monitor Energy Usage: Track power consumption to identify areas for further optimization.
Real-World Impact: Optimizing the power supply can reduce electricity costs and improve the overall profitability of your mining operations.
5. Enhancing Network Connectivity
Reliable network connectivity is crucial for solo mining, as delays in block template updates can reduce your chances of success. Consider these upgrades:
- Wired Ethernet Connection: Use a wired connection for lower latency and greater stability compared to Wi-Fi.
- Network Monitoring Tools: Implement tools to monitor network performance and detect potential issues.
- Redundant Connections: Set up a secondary network connection as a backup to ensure uninterrupted mining.
Real-World Impact: Improved network connectivity reduces downtime and ensures your miner operates at maximum efficiency.

Best Practices for Modifying the Bitaxe Ultra
While upgrading your Bitaxe Ultra can yield significant benefits, it’s essential to follow best practices to avoid potential pitfalls:
- Backup Original Settings: Before making any modifications, save the original firmware and settings to ensure you can revert if needed.
- Test Incrementally: Make changes one at a time and test stability before proceeding to the next modification.
- Monitor Performance: Use monitoring tools to track hashrate, temperature, and power consumption during and after upgrades.
- Prioritize Safety: Avoid pushing the hardware beyond its safe operating limits to prevent damage.
